"Chronicles" is grounded in honesty and self-reflection—tenets Cordae highlighted as central to his growth between his debut and this project. The lyrics and visual together explore the delicate balance between professional ambition ("can't waste no time") and personal devotion ("if you left me now, I know how far I'd regret it").
